On April 28, 1945, Nixon and Easy Company arrived at the Kaufering IV concentration camp in Landsberg am Lech and saw with their own eyes the horrors of the Holocaust the Nazis decided to burn the camp barracks with the prisoners locked inside them as Allied troops approached. He returned home in September 1945.[11]. The 12th Armored Division had arrived a day prior, but Nixon, Winters, and the 101st Airborne Division were met by 500 charred corpses still riddling the grounds. Captain Lewis Nixon III (September 30, 1918 - January 11, 1995) [1] was a United States Army officer who, during World War II, served with Easy Company of the 2nd Battalion, 506th Parachute Infantry Regiment, part of the 101st Airborne Division ("The Screaming Eagles"). Born Lewis Nixon III on September 30, 1918, in New York City, he was the eldest of the three children of Stanhope Wood Nixon and Doris Ryer Nixon.
